Leadership Review Briefing — Board

Quick update before Thursday's session: Pellward Industries finally sent over their term sheet for the Lumenstrait partnership. Terms are broadly what we expected — revenue share is a touch lean, but the exclusivity window works in our favor. Counsel is reviewing now. For the board's eyes, the strategic rationale is set out in the note below.

internal memo for kawip-hadug: Headcount on the Wenwyn team goes from 7 to 140 by the end of January. Gross margin on Wenwyn came in at 20 percent against a plan of 15 percent.

### Step 2: Switch to Pooled Connections

Marrowdb clients must move off direct connections before the Thornvale cutover. Direct mode is removed in this release; tickets about "connection refused" after upgrade almost always mean the pooler settings were skipped. Pool size is per-replica, not global — do not multiply it yourself. Idle timeout below 30s causes churn; leave the shipped default unless told otherwise. Restart the app tier after applying. Apply the following pooler configuration on each replica.

deployment values, fahap-hahaf:
[casdor]
port = 9200
region = south-2
host = casdor.qirvanworks.corp
timeout_ms = 3000
retries = 4

Subject: Tideline widget 1.4 — notes for plugin authors

Hello all,

The Tideline tide-table widget now exposes high/low predictions as a structured array instead of preformatted strings. Plugins that parsed the old text output will break; switch to the new fields for timestamp, height, and phase. Units follow the host app's locale settings, and the widget no longer rounds heights to one decimal. Sample harbors ship in the dev kit. Compatibility testing should target the build listed below.

trace token, fafog-kageg: htk4_98e6

Key Ceremony Checklist — SquatterScan package scanner

[ ] Step 4 of 9: Generate the new attestation keypair for SquatterScan's registry-monitoring signer. Verify the fingerprint aloud with both custodians present, record it in the ceremony log, and confirm the hardware token is write-locked afterward. Future maintainers: the escrow copy stays in the Dunmarsh safe. Restoring it later requires the recovery phrase recorded immediately below this step.

vault phrase of bagaf-kajeg = jorath-feniel-briir-siliel-ralix